Transaction 98136e4ee577e6f704b77a5bbc8edaf68f92e18ac1b0b786c28f04c8a9b84ae5
1 Input
1 Output
-
98136e4ee577e6f704b77a5bbc8edaf68f92e18ac1b0b786c28f04c8a9b84ae5:0
- value
- 23860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f1304752afa806f7d11c18a8ac74c11672ed21c OP_EQUAL
- address
- 34XKeqsomK9PzfTBbwnUXeX4HmiaGcdmXK